急倾斜煤层煤巷支护试验研究

Experimental Study on Supports of Seam Roadways in Deeply Inclined Coal Seams

【摘要】 对急倾斜煤层中的永久性巷道的支护方式的选择及支护效果进行了系统研究。针对急倾斜煤层中巷道围岩活动的特点,从其支护所面临的困境入手,采用动态设计方法,通过实验室相似模拟、数值模拟和现场测试等综合手段,得出了锚梁网支护方式是该类巷道最有效的支护方式的结论,并取得了理想的支护效果。试验表明采用的设计方法是科学合理的,填补了急倾斜煤层巷道支护理论和设计方法的空白。该研究成果将给类似条件下的巷道支护提供有益的借鉴,因而有广阔的应用前景。

【Abstract】 This paper discusses the selection of supports of perpetual gateways in steeply inclined seams,and evaluates the support effects.Considering the characteristics of the present problems of the support method of gateways in complex surrounding rock in steeply inclined seams,laboratory scale modeling and numerical simulation are made and in situ tests are carried out.It is concluded that bolt-mesh-anchor is the most effective supporting measure for this sort of gateways.The effectiveness of practical application of this type of supporting structure is found to be satisfactory.The dynamic design method adopted in this paper provides a effective means of designing roadway support in deeply inclined seams.This study will be of reference value to other similar mines and is expected to find wide application.
